## Depgraph Viewer

Grapnel renders the dependency graph for every Mossfield service. Reviewers: before approving any change that adds a dependency, load the affected module in Grapnel and confirm no cycles or layer violations appear. Red edges are blocking; amber edges need a justification comment in the PR. Refresh runs hourly, so rebuild manually after merging. Usage instructions and the layer policy are on the internal page.

runbook for badug-kadup: https://confluence.zemvarlabs.internal/projects/browse/display/projects/bd1b

**First-day checklist — Fire-drill roll call (contractors)**

On arrival at Dunmore Works, register at the gatehouse so your name appears on the muster sheet. During a drill, assemble at Point C by the cycle shelter and answer when the warden from Larkspur Projects calls the contractor list. Do not leave until dismissed. To re-enter the building after the all-clear, use the pass code below.

staff pass of kawip-hawef = bdg-QLP-2

## Changelog — v2.14.1

Renamed `CRON_SKEW_TOLERANCE` to `SCHEDULER_DRIFT_WINDOW_MS` after the Pellwick drift investigation showed the old name implied seconds, not milliseconds. The Tarnell ops team traced missed invoice runs to operators setting `30` expecting half a minute. Migration shims accept both names through v2.16 and log a deprecation warning. Reviewers should confirm the rename is reflected in staging env files. The drift monitor also now requires signed heartbeats, so add the signing credential to the env file on the line below.

vault entry, yahif-yajep: COURIER_KEY29=b802bdf8034096b65a51c6ba5abe2